Cummins Accounts Payable decreased by 0.5% to $3.80B in Q4 2025 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ric declined by 3.8%, from $3.95B to $3.80B. Over 5 years (FY 2020 to FY 2025), Accounts Payable shows an upward trend with a 6.1% CAGR.
An increase can indicate better credit terms or increased production volume, while a decrease might suggest faster payments or reduced purchasing.

accounts_payable| Q2 '21 | Q3 '21 | Q4 '21 | Q1 '22 | Q2 '22 | Q3 '22 | Q4 '22 | Q1 '23 | Q2 '23 | Q3 '23 | Q4 '23 | Q1 '24 | Q2 '24 | Q3 '24 | Q4 '24 | Q1 '25 | Q2 '25 | Q3 '25 | Q4 '25 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Value | $3.17B | $3.21B | $3.02B | $3.50B | $3.41B | $4.00B | $4.25B | $4.64B | $4.31B | $4.26B | $4.26B | $4.48B | $4.41B | $4.21B | $3.95B | $4.31B | $4.15B | $3.82B | $3.80B |
| QoQ Change | — | +1.2% | -5.9% | +15.8% | -2.6% | +17.5% | +6.3% | +9.0% | -7.1% | -1.1% | -0.0% | +5.1% | -1.6% | -4.5% | -6.1% | +9.1% | -3.7% | -8.0% | -0.5% |
| YoY Change | — | — | — | — | +7.3% | +24.6% | +40.7% | +32.6% | +26.5% | +6.6% | +0.2% | -3.5% | +2.3% | -1.3% | -7.3% | -3.7% | -5.8% | -9.2% | -3.8% |
